also i want to ask somethin more. I saw this video http://www.youtube.com/watch?feature...&v=WHNw2E4tU6c (to see the steps after the e3 flasher part) and at this time in video it shows the lights 10:14. My lights from e3 flasher is exactly the same except the blue ones. They aren't so bright. I barerly see them. Why?
poor connection from clip to chip. You need more pressure on the clip. E3 flasher gets power from nor chip so if your's are dim you need a better connection. Hope this helps.
